Zener voltage is measured with the device junction in thermal equilibrium with an ambient temperature of 25 °C. 4. Zener Impedance Derivation ZZT and ZZK are measured by dividing the AC voltage drop across the device by the AC current applied. The specified limits are for IZ(ac) = 0.1 IZ(dc) with the ac frequency = 60 Hz. |
